Transaction 8886ef2c63cbbd136aededf0db342c6da0917264874e2c12fa81974826ff2343
1 Input
1 Output
-
8886ef2c63cbbd136aededf0db342c6da0917264874e2c12fa81974826ff2343:0
- value
- 286959
- script pubkey
- OP_0 OP_PUSHBYTES_20 20937a6b9706f4ecc80b764a58fa089bcb00a340
- address
- bc1qyzfh56uhqm6wejqtwe9937sgn09spg6qgrnr3m